Re: “First Bite: Husk Nashville

My two cents:

Not a fan of the decor at all. I ate in the purple dining room on the street level, and wasn't particularly taken with the art or purple walls. I do love the exterior of the building, and the downstairs dining room looked nice.

Went for lunch last week. My grouper was overcooked. The accouterments with it were good. The fried green tomatoes were unremarkable. Lockeland Table's version is considerably better. I tried someone else's catfish BLT, not impressed. I did enjoy the Benton's ham plate, and i had a bite of a pretty tasty burger. I'll definitely give it another chance at dinner in the near future.

At this point, it may be a victim of its own hype. I must admit, my expectations were pretty high.

Re: “Tennessee's Stiff-Arm Is an Outstretched Hand

Adam, the map is about *federal aid,* which doesn't include all federal spending. Defense and Social Security aren't considered federal aid. For example, in 2010 the federal government spent about $650 billion in federal aid -- things like farm subsidies, transportation projects, environmental programs -- while state budgets totaled about $1.5 trillion.

And all those suburbanites benefit heavily from an interstate system that provides them access to their jobs in Davidson County, and from Davidson County infrastructure. Take a look at the roads on any weekday morning to look at commuting patterns.
